Bundesliga giants Borussia Dortmund are keen to push the development of Ghanaian pair Joseph Claude-Gyau and Evans Nyarko as they have sent the duo to play with their team B. 

Dortmund manager Jurgen Klopp asked the duo to join David Wagner's side and they have both been named in their line-up to face Jahn Regensburg in the third round game of the German third-tier.

BVBII Line-up: Alomerovic - Narey, Stankovic, Hornschuh, Güll - Solga, Nyarko - Jordanov, Gyau, Maruoka - Harder.

The pair spent the opening parts of pre-season with the Dortmund first team squad under Klopp but due to the early start of the Liga 3, they have been asked to begin their season with the team B.

Gyau impressed while on pre-season with Dortmund's first team squad scoring 4 four goals before joining the team B while Nyarko has been around since last season.
